"Come for splurge-y dinners of filet mignon with Jack Daniel’s whisky sauce and dijon-crusted lamb shanks, all surrounded by sea views. Or drop anchor in the afternoon during the spot’s legendary raw bar happy hour — a perfectly luxe way to cool off after a day at the Provincetown Inn’s pool. Toss back Manhattans and Earl Grey martinis as you dive into Wellfleet oysters and clams, plus lobster tails, and ceviche specials of the day." - Nathan Tavares

Boatslip Resort & Beach Club

Beach club · Provincetown

Adults-only, gay-friendly hotel with relaxed rooms, poolside parties, free breakfast & a buzzy bar. Open seasonally, this iconic, adults-only hotel catering to lesbians and gay men overlooks Cape Cod Bay, and is set among lively Commercial Street's shops, cafes and art galleries. Herring Cove Beach is 2 miles away. Relaxed rooms feature minifridges, free Wi-Fi and flat-screen TVs. Upgraded rooms add private balconies and pool or bay views. Amenities include complimentary continental breakfast served in an atrium lounge, as well as loaner beach towels, and reserved lounge chairs on a wood deck next to a buzzy bar and the heated outdoor pool. There are also popular afternoon dance parties. Minimum-stay rules may apply.

Marine Specialties

Army & navy surplus shop · Provincetown

Marine Specialties has been a Provincetown landmark for over 50 years. Often known simply as "the army-navy store," Marine Specialties is an eclectic treasure trove of salvage, surplus, slight IRs, closeouts, overruns, misprints, mistakes, spare parts, odd lots, cast-offs, and new and nearly-new items. Over time it's grown to be the kind of jumbled, inclusive, and eccentric "army-navy" store Provincetown deserves. Many people young and old call this their favorite shop.
